You won't need PS Plus for Netflix or party chat, and your friends list will cap at 2,000

Sony has confirmed that you won't need a PS Plus subscription to make use of the PlayStation 4's party chat functionality


Sony has released another Q&A video, and in it they talk about alot of changes between PS3 and PS4, and one of them is that 'Party Chat' will no longer required you to have an valid PSN+ account.

At the moment, a PlayStation Plus subscription is needed to the online multiplayer of most titles, though services like Netflix, party chat, and free-to-play games like DC Universe Online will be available without it.

Additionally, the video also confirms that PlayStation 4 friends lists will be capped at 2,000 people, DualShock 3 controllers won't work with the PS4 while the PlayStation Move will, and your PSN avatar and username will carry over to PlayStation 4 along with a host of privacy options.

One of the biggest concerns fans have raised about the PlayStation 4 is just how many features will be accessible without owning a PS Plus account.
